自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 收藏
  • 关注

原创 Invalid credentials for ‘https://repo.magento.com/archives/magento/composer/magento-composer-1.0.2.0

magento2使用composer安装程序需要验证公钥和私钥如图所示用户名和密码对应公钥和私钥Sign inhttps://marketplace.magento.com/customer/accessKeys/如果没有账号就是创建一个

2022-03-29 23:26:51 395

原创 magento2 main.CRITICAL: Class Magento\Framework\App\Http\Interceptor does not exist

用下面命令行安装magento2后php bin/magento setup:install --base-url="http://yoururl.com/" --db-host="localhost" --db-name="dbname" --db-user="dbuser" --db-password="dbpass" --admin-firstname="admin" --admin-lastname="admin" --admin-email="user@example.com

2022-03-13 20:53:54 613

原创 excel表格时间戳转日期公式(函数)

秒级:=TEXT((A1+8*3600)/86400+70*365+19,"yyyy-mm-dd hh:mm:ss")毫秒级:=TEXT((A1/1000+8*3600)/86400+70*365+19,"yyyy-mm-dd hh:mm:ss")

2022-02-15 17:39:05 1075

原创 linux环境去空格PHP开发

开发环境是window,正式环境是linux,当时开发是去除字符串两边的空格,和数组匹配,开发环境没问题,上线到正式环境就匹配不到,后面发现是window的去空格在linux不适用,window:$str = str_replace(PHP_EOL, '', $str);$data = str_replace(' ', "", $data);linux:$str = preg_replace("/(\s|\&nbsp\;| |\xc2\xa0)/","",$str);...

2022-01-18 16:58:13 463

原创 Nginx允许跨域访问(请求状态:CORS error)

允许nginx跨域访问项目:server{ listen 80; server_name xxxxx.com; index index.php index.html index.htm default.php default.htm default.html; root /www/wwwroot/project/public; # 允许跨域GET,POST,DELETE HTTP方法发起跨域请求 add_header 'Access-Co

2022-01-12 18:18:09 6067

原创 centos安装php的zip扩展-Fatal error: Class ‘ZipArchive‘ not found in /**目录

错误提示:Error: Class 'ZipArchive' not found原因:linux上压缩都是使用的zlib套件,包括nginx\httpd这种,PHP也是调用系统压缩组件解决办法:确认环境已安装php_zip扩展后,修改php.ini中zlib.output_compression = Off 改为 zlib.output_compression = On重启nginx 或者apache...

2021-12-31 10:15:57 1720

原创 Failed to clone https://github.com/magento/magento-composer-installer.git, git was not found

在win10系统安装magento2.1的时候,在命令行里输入composer install 时输出如下报错提示Failed to clone https://github.com/magento/magento-composer-installer.git, git was not found解决方案:把项目根目录下的composer.lock文件删除,再重新运行composer install...

2021-11-15 14:07:10 1880

原创 Fatal error: Uncaught Error: Call to undefined function wp()

原因:wordpress项目的wp-config文件内容为空解决方案:重新覆盖wp-config内容

2021-10-22 17:39:00 2204

原创 tp6安装多应用时 could not find package topthink/think-multi-app

出现的错误: [InvalidArgumentException] Could not find packagetopthink/think-multi-app.解决方案:删除之前的镜像:composer config -g --unset repos.packagist

2021-08-14 18:44:55 858

原创 window+apache安装magento2.3.4(安装成功css,js显示500状态)

在window下安装magento2.3.4在window下安装magento2.3.4在window下安装magento2.3.4我是使用小皮面板安装magento2.3.4(非常推荐大家使用小皮面板)之前安装magento2.3.4踩了太多坑,官方是推荐使用nginx安装,但是window安装也是可以的,只是要修改一下代码,和伪静态,废话不多说,直接开始:1.首先我们去magento官方的github上下载magento2.3.4的压缩包,https://github.com/magento/ma

2021-05-07 17:12:19 889

原创 Yii生成excel表

Yii生成excel表/** * 下载excel表格 * @return string */ public function actionDownload(){ //实例化excel类 $objPHPExcel = new \PHPExcel(); //设置文件属性 $objPHPExcel->getProperties()->setCreator("ira") ->setLastModifiedBy("ira") ->setTitl

2021-03-19 17:30:05 159

原创 PHP字符串去除重复值

PHP字符串去除重复值//explode(',',$data)将字符串已,拆分组成数组//array_unique() 数组去除重复值//implode(',',$data))) 将数组用,拆分组合成字符串$data = "xiaomi,xiaohong,xiaogang,xiaomi,xiaohu";$data = implode(',',array_unique(explode(',',$data))); echo $data;//结果是$data="xiaomi,xiaohong,xia

2021-03-17 15:29:03 435

原创 PHP实现分页功能(原生PHP代码+bootstrap)

PHP实现分页功能(原生PHP代码+bootstrap开发说明图片代码开发说明这是接着我上一个ajax获取表单提交内容博文,在原来的页面增加分页功能!分页的样式是用bootstrap。废话不多说直接上代码图片代码<script src="js/bootstrap.min.js"></script><body><?php // 1.连接$link = @mysqli_connect('localhost','user','password');

2021-02-26 15:32:06 736

原创 JS获取form表单提交的数据(ajax获取表单提交数据进行请求)

JS获取form表单提交的数据提交(ajax)在html页面不想用form表单提交,但是表单数据是遍历出来的,所以可以用这个方法获取遍历的form表单点击要提交的的数据,废话不多说直接上代码代码部分//这是我用PHP写的<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ns

2021-01-22 15:42:16 2571

原创 MySQL错误:SQLSTATE[42000]: Syntax error or access violation

MySQL错误:SQLSTATE[42000]: Syntax error or access violation:问题描述:查询数据是遇到这个问题(mysql5.7)原因分析:后面查资料才知道是sql_mode=“ONLY_FULL_GROUP_BY”,原来是我们mysql升级到5.7后才会遇到,mysql5.6没有这个问题 这个是因为mysql5.6中没有这个配置sql_mode="ONLY_FULL_GROUP_BY"而mysql5.7默认了这个配置,所以我们要在mysql5.7中取消这

2021-01-20 10:54:03 13634 2

原创 ThankPHP5.0增加中英文转换(tp5语言翻译)

ThankPHP5.0增加中英文转换(tp5语言翻译)这个中英文转换是点击触发的,默认是显示中文的语言,框架使用的是thankphp5.0.24 。废话不多说直接上代码提示:以下是本篇文章正文内容,下面案例可供参考代码在项目根目录下thankphp>convention.php配置文件下找到以下代码。 // 是否开启多语言 'lang_switch_on' => true, // 默认全局过滤方法 用逗号分隔多个 'default_fil

2021-01-12 17:50:45 928

原创 navicat premium15修改表的数据存储引擎engine(myisam和innodb)

navicat premium15修改表的数据存储引擎(myisam和innodb)在创建数据表的时候,很多人都会忽略数据表的数据存储引擎选项,这个会关系到以后数据表的增删改查以及事务的使用,数据存储引擎(engine)我们常用的有两种:第一是myisam(建表的时候不填就会默认选项) 它适合查询注重性能(适合小白测试数据量少),不支持事务 第二是innodb,它适合数据量大 支持事务...

2021-01-04 17:37:54 4694 1

原创 PHP(Yii2)实现中转请求POST数据(PHP请求表单数据Yii2框架如何接收json数据)

PHP实现中转请求POST数据(PHP请求表单数据Yii2如何接收json数据)这是post请求表单json数据,接收数据要做的一些事情:<?phpdate_default_timezone_set('PRC');header("Content-type: text/html; charset=utf-8");//获取推送输入流XML$datas = file_get_contents("php://input"); $request_data = json_decode(strip

2020-12-31 18:58:52 792

原创 php计算字符串在字符串中出现的次数substr_count()

php计算字符串在字符串中出现的次数substr_count()废话不多说,直接上代码: $str = "abcdchg" $num = substr_count($str,'c'); echo $num;输出结果为:2

2020-11-12 18:37:19 126

原创 thinkphp5使用bootstrap实现分页功能(php实现分页功能)

thinkphp5使用bootstrap实现分页功能(php实现分页功能)这是在tp5.0的基础上使用bootstrap的分页和表格实现的,废话不多说直接上代码://这是前端展示代码<div class="example-wrap"> <div class="example"> <table id="cusTable"> <thead> <th data-field="

2020-11-10 16:30:37 836

原创 php和thinkphp5实时统计下载量

php和thinkphp5实时统计下载量这次是在tp5.0的基础上做的统计下载量,我的思路是在php后台的下载方法中加入统计数量的代码(就是方法运行一次就往数据库字段加1),展示数据的时候就从数据库(建表就两个字段id 和 downloadConut)拿值。废话不多说,直接上代码<!--超文本标记语言这是前端页面代码,用于显示下载量 --!> <div class="aaa"> <div class="bbb">

2020-11-09 18:14:59 343

原创 thinkphp5.0使用header文件下载(php使用header文件下载)

thinkphp5.0文件下载(php文件下载)这是tp5的文件下载方法,也基本适用php的文件下载,废话不多说,直接上代码: $file = $file_path; //这是文件目录 if(file_exists($file)){ header("Content-type:application/octet-stream"); $filename = basename($file); header("Content-Dispos

2020-11-09 10:20:27 605

原创 ThinkPHP5 select下拉标签if判断默认值

ThinkPHP模板IF标签用法详解ThinkPHP5模板在前端html用到的select下拉选项option判断默认值。代码//html代码<div class="form-group"> <label class="col-sm-3 control-label">图片类型:</label> <div class="input-group col-sm-4"> <select class="form-contro

2020-11-06 14:29:34 1262

原创 yii2Object报错 Cannot use yii\base\Object as Object because ‘Object‘ is a special class name

yii2报错 Cannot use yii\base\Object as Object because ‘Object’ is a special class nameyii2版本兼容问题,yii2.0.38 php<=7.0``

2020-10-26 09:29:26 562

原创 yii2接入pgSQL(查询不到表The table does not exist: {{%user}})

yii2框架接入pgSQL(查询不到表The table does not exist: {{%user}})我是yii2的框架做的系统接的是MySQL数据库,后面因为其他情况又要去接pgSQL,导致遇到上面的情况,我的情况是我的pgSQL数据库下有账号的表两个,我用的是第一个账号下的表,但系统获取的是第二个public账号下的表,导致系统运行要查询表的时候就会报错The table does not exist: {{%user}}.解决办法:在yii2项目中的config/db.php中加入以

2020-10-23 14:21:15 1711

原创 phpstudy.小皮面板安装magento2商城(Vendor autoload is not found. Please run ‘composer install‘ under applica)

https://www.zuimoban.com/php/magento/11633.html

2020-10-20 14:06:14 2193

原创 微信小程序php后端接收小程序前端数组(array)

php后端接收微信小程序前端数组(array)php后端接收微信小程序前端数组(array)废话不多说,直接上代码前端代码js:var a = array();wx.util.request({ url: "re/wxapp/class", data: { op: "getArray", control: "book", uniacid: uniacid,

2020-08-14 14:46:07 1266

原创 微信小程序CSS样式图片闪烁

微信小程序CSS样式图片闪烁微信小程序直接用CSS样式让图片闪烁起来!!!废话不多说!直接上代码// 这是设置小程序WXSS页面.shanshuo{-webkit-animation: twinkling 2s infinite ease-in-out;}@-webkit-keyframes twinkling{0% {opacity: 0; }100% {opacity: 1; }}...

2020-05-20 17:28:57 1523

原创 微信小程序scroll-view横向滚动的使用

微信小程序横向滚动微信小程序横向滚动这是最简单易懂的小程序页面内容横向滚动的方法之一,这里会用到小程序原生组件:srcoll-view,以及如何设置组件的属性和设置组件的css样式。废话不多说,直接上代码。// 这是设置小程序WXML页面<scroll-view class="scroll-w" scroll-x> <view class="item"></view></scroll-view>// 这是设置小程序WXSS页面.scroll

2020-05-20 17:17:06 767

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除